Lisa goes to the mall one day and buys four shirts and three pairs of pants for $85.50. She returns the next day and buys three

shirts and five pairs of pants for $115.00. What is the price of each shirt and each pair of pants?

Answer:the price for one shirt is $7.5

the price for one pair of pants is $18.5

Step-by-step explanation:

Let x represent the price for one shirt.

Let y represent the price for one pair of pants.

Lisa goes to the mall one day and buys four shirts and three pairs of pants for $85.50. This means that

4x + 3y = 85.5 - - - - - - - - - -1

She returns the next day and buys three shirts and five pairs of pants for $115.00. This means that

3x + 5y = 115 - - - - - - - - - - - 2

Multiplying equation 1 by b3 and equation 2 by 4, it becomes

12x + 9y = 256.5

12x + 20y = 460

Subtracting, it becomes

- 11y = - 203.5

y = - 203.5/ -11 = 18.5

Substituting y = 18.5 into equation 1, it becomes

4x + 3×18.5 = 85.5

4x + 55.5 = 85.5

4x = 85.5 - 55.5 = 30

x = 30/4 = 7.5
